Post by zpilot on Aug 18, 2017 18:38:19 GMT -7
I have bought a bunch of tubes from them. All worked fine. I didn't care for their Preferred Series 7189 in my MAZ 18. A little too smooth. That's just personal preference and is subjective. They worked fine for the time I had them in the amp. I really like their Preferred Series 6L6GC though. That's what I recommend for amps I repair.

Post by easyed on Sept 17, 2017 14:52:28 GMT -7
I've read in some other forums that their "Preferred Series" tubes aren't any better (or as good as) he same designation tube with it's manufacturer's name (or New Sensors brand name) on it.
More specifically, I've seen reports about 7025's. I've stopped trying current production 7025's, because I found one from GT that was highly microphonic (brand new). IME current production 12AX7's have worked in every socket that called for a 7025 - don't waste money.
